Internet, phone service gradually returns after vanishing for most of Gaza amid heavy bombardment

  • Internet connectivity is being restored in the Gaza Strip after a two-day disruption caused by Israeli bombardment, according to global network monitor Netblocks.
  • Palestine Telecommunications and Jawwal Telecommunication Company confirm the gradual restoration of landline, cellular, and internet services in Gaza. These services were disrupted due to the ongoing aggression.
  • Despite the severity of the situation, technical teams are working to repair the network and minimize damage, as stated by Paltel.
